数控加工基础知识课件.ppt
《数控加工基础知识课件.ppt》由会员分享,可在线阅读,更多相关《数控加工基础知识课件.ppt(115页珍藏版)》请在冰豆网上搜索。
数控加工基础知识11数控加工基础知识数控机床的分类数控机床及其工作原理数控坐标系数控编程基础知识数控车削编程数控铣削编程编程举例22一.数控机床及其工作原理
(一)数控机床的概念:
数控又称为数字控制数控又称为数字控制(NumericalControl),(NumericalControl),是一是一种利用数字化信息发出指令并实现自动控制的技术种利用数字化信息发出指令并实现自动控制的技术.数控机床是采用了数字控制技术的加工设备数控机床是采用了数字控制技术的加工设备,它通它通过数字化信息对机床的运动方向及加工过程进行控制过数字化信息对机床的运动方向及加工过程进行控制,实现要求的机械动作实现要求的机械动作,并自动完成加工任务并自动完成加工任务.它是一种它是一种典型的技术密集且自动化程度很高的机电一体化产品典型的技术密集且自动化程度很高的机电一体化产品.
(二)数控机床的产生与发展:
数控机床诞生于美国数控机床诞生于美国.1952.1952年年,美国帕森斯公司与美国帕森斯公司与麻省理工学院共同研制成功了世界上第一台数控机床麻省理工学院共同研制成功了世界上第一台数控机床,用来加工直升机叶片轮廓检查用样板用来加工直升机叶片轮廓检查用样板.半个世纪以来半个世纪以来,数控技术得到了迅猛的发展数控技术得到了迅猛的发展,其加工精度和加工效率不其加工精度和加工效率不断提高断提高.数控机床发展至今已经历了两个阶段共六个时数控机床发展至今已经历了两个阶段共六个时代代.33一.数控机床及其工作原理(续)1.硬件数控阶段:
(NC)早期的计算机运算速度低,不能适应机床实时控制的要求,人们只好用数字逻辑电路搭成一台机床专用计算机作为数控系统,这就是硬件连接数控,简称数控(NC).这个阶段一共经历了三代,即第一代的电子管数控机床,第二代的晶体管数控机床,第三代的小规模集成电路数控机床.44一.数控机床及其工作原理(续)2.计算机数控阶段:
(CNC)这个阶段也经历了三代:
即第四代的小型计算机数控机床,第五代的微型计算机数控机床以及第六代基于PC的数控机床.前三代数控机床采用专用控制计算机的硬件数控装置,早已被淘汰;后三代的数控机床,则以小型微型计算机取代硬件控制计算机作为核心部件,数控机床的许多控制功能由专用软件实现,其数控系统被称为软件控制系统,又称CNC系统.55一.数控机床及其工作原理(续)(三)数控机床的特点:
1.具有高柔性.2.生产效率高,减少辅助时间和机动时间.3.加工精度高,产品质量稳定.4自动化程度高,劳动强度低.5能加工形状复杂的零件.66(四)数控机床的工作原理77数控机床加工演示数控车床加工88数控机床加工演示数控车铣中心加工99二二.数控机床的分类数控机床的分类(一一)按工艺用途分类按工艺用途分类:
()金属切削类数控机床()金属切削类数控机床:
*:
*普通数控机床:
如普通数控机床:
如数控车床数控车床、数控铣床数控铣床、数控钻床等数控钻床等*复合型数控复合型数控机床机床:
如铣镗加工中心如铣镗加工中心、车铣加工中心等车铣加工中心等.()金属成型类数控机床:
如数控折弯机()金属成型类数控机床:
如数控折弯机、数数控弯管机控弯管机、数控转头压力机等数控转头压力机等()数控特种加工机床:
如数控线切割机()数控特种加工机床:
如数控线切割机、数数控电火花加工机床控电火花加工机床、数控激光切割机床等数控激光切割机床等()其它类型数控机床:
如数控三坐标测量仪()其它类型数控机床:
如数控三坐标测量仪等等1010二数控机床分类(续)(二二)按运动轨迹分类按运动轨迹分类:
A.A.点位控制数控机床点位控制数控机床:
它控制机床移动部件它控制机床移动部件由一个点准确地移动由一个点准确地移动到另一个点到另一个点,而对运动而对运动轨迹没有严格要求轨迹没有严格要求.在在移动和定位过程中刀移动和定位过程中刀具不进行任何切削加具不进行任何切削加工工.如数控钻床等如数控钻床等.1111二数控机床分类(续)B.B.直线控制数控机床直线控制数控机床:
刀具相对于工件的移刀具相对于工件的移动轨迹是平行于机床动轨迹是平行于机床某一坐标轴或者与坐某一坐标轴或者与坐标轴成标轴成4545度夹角的直度夹角的直线线,刀具在移动过程中刀具在移动过程中进行切削进行切削.早期的数控早期的数控车床车床、数控铣床等使数控铣床等使用这类控制系统用这类控制系统.1212二数控机床分类(续)C.轮廓控制(连续控制)数控机床:
能控制两个或两个以上的坐标轴,对坐标轴的方向、行程、运动速度进行严格连续控制,可加工由任意斜线、曲线和曲面组成的复杂零件.1313(三)按可控制联动的坐标轴分类1.1.两轴联动数控机床两轴联动数控机床:
数控机床能同时控制两个数控机床能同时控制两个坐标轴联动坐标轴联动,可用于加工各可用于加工各种回转体零件种回转体零件.如数控车床如数控车床.2.2.两轴半联动数控机床两轴半联动数控机床:
数控机床有三个坐标轴数控机床有三个坐标轴,能能做三个方向的运动做三个方向的运动,但数控但数控装置只能同时控制两个坐装置只能同时控制两个坐标轴标轴,第三轴只能作等距周第三轴只能作等距周期运动期运动,可加工空间曲面可加工空间曲面.1414(三)按可控制联动的坐标轴分类3.3.3.3.三轴联动数控机床三轴联动数控机床三轴联动数控机床三轴联动数控机床:
数控机床能同时控制三个数控机床能同时控制三个数控机床能同时控制三个数控机床能同时控制三个坐标轴联动坐标轴联动坐标轴联动坐标轴联动,可用于加工曲可用于加工曲可用于加工曲可用于加工曲面零件,如数控铣床面零件,如数控铣床面零件,如数控铣床面零件,如数控铣床4.4.4.4.多轴联动数控机床多轴联动数控机床多轴联动数控机床多轴联动数控机床:
数控机床能同时控制三个数控机床能同时控制三个数控机床能同时控制三个数控机床能同时控制三个以上坐标轴联动以上坐标轴联动以上坐标轴联动以上坐标轴联动,可使刀具可使刀具可使刀具可使刀具轴线方向在一定的空间内轴线方向在一定的空间内轴线方向在一定的空间内轴线方向在一定的空间内任意控制任意控制任意控制任意控制,主要用于加工异主要用于加工异主要用于加工异主要用于加工异形复杂的零件形复杂的零件形复杂的零件形复杂的零件.1515数控机床加工演示数控机床多轴联动加工1616(四)按伺服系统类型分类A.A.开环伺服系统数控机床开环伺服系统数控机床:
它没有位置检测装置和反馈装置它没有位置检测装置和反馈装置,不能对移动工作不能对移动工作台实际移动距离进行位置测量和反馈台实际移动距离进行位置测量和反馈,其移动部件其移动部件的位移精度主要决定于进给传动系统各有关零件的位移精度主要决定于进给传动系统各有关零件的制造精度的制造精度.1717B.闭环伺服系统数控机床有位置测量和反馈装置有位置测量和反馈装置,加工中将工作台实际位移加工中将工作台实际位移量的检测结果反馈给数控装置量的检测结果反馈给数控装置,并与输入的指令进并与输入的指令进行比较行比较、校正,直至误差值为零校正,直至误差值为零.其特点是加工精其特点是加工精度高度高,但结构复杂但结构复杂,设计和调试较困难设计和调试较困难.1818C.半闭环伺服系统数控机床其位置检测装置不直接测量机床工作台的位移量其位置检测装置不直接测量机床工作台的位移量,而是通过检测丝杆转角而是通过检测丝杆转角,间接地测量工作台的位移间接地测量工作台的位移量量,并反馈给数控装置进行位置校正并反馈给数控装置进行位置校正.在精度要求在精度要求适中的中小型数控机床上适中的中小型数控机床上,半闭环控制得到了广泛半闭环控制得到了广泛的应用的应用.1919三.数控机床坐标系与工件坐标系1.1.机床坐标系机床坐标系:
为了确定机床的运动方向为了确定机床的运动方向与运动距离与运动距离,以描述刀具与以描述刀具与工件之间的位置与变化关工件之间的位置与变化关系系,我们需要建立机床坐标我们需要建立机床坐标系系.确认机床坐标系应遵循的确认机床坐标系应遵循的基本原则是基本原则是:
(1)
(1)刀具相对于静止零件运刀具相对于静止零件运动原则动原则.
(2)
(2)机床坐标系采用右手直机床坐标系采用右手直角笛卡尔坐标系角笛卡尔坐标系.2020右手笛卡儿坐标系右手的大拇指右手的大拇指、食指和中食指和中指互相垂直时指互相垂直时,拇指的方向拇指的方向为为XX轴的正方向轴的正方向,食指为食指为YY轴轴的正方向的正方向,中指为中指为ZZ轴的正轴的正方向方向.以以XX、YY、ZZ坐标轴线坐标轴线或以与或以与XX、YY、ZZ坐标轴平行坐标轴平行的坐标轴线为中心旋转的的坐标轴线为中心旋转的圆周进给坐标轴分别以圆周进给坐标轴分别以AA、BB、CC表示表示,其正方向由右其正方向由右手螺旋法则确定手螺旋法则确定.2121机床坐标系各坐标轴确定的顺序先确定先确定ZZ轴轴:
与主轴轴线平与主轴轴线平行或重合的坐标轴为行或重合的坐标轴为ZZ轴轴,以刀具远离工件的方向为以刀具远离工件的方向为正向正向.再确定再确定XX轴轴:
平行于工件装平行于工件装夹面夹面,与与ZZ轴垂直的水平方轴垂直的水平方向的坐标轴为向的坐标轴为XX轴轴,以刀具以刀具远离工件的方向为正向远离工件的方向为正向.最后确定最后确定YY轴轴:
当当XX轴和轴和ZZ轴轴确定以后确定以后,利用右手法则确利用右手法则确定定YY轴及其正方向轴及其正方向.2222车车床床坐坐标标系系+Z+x024模块二数控机床结构及主要部件立式数控铣床坐标系+02525机床原点与机床参考点机床坐标系是机床上固有机床坐标系是机床上固有的坐标系的坐标系,其原点称为机床其原点称为机床原点原点,由厂家设定位置由厂家设定位置,不不允许用户更改允许用户更改.而机床参考而机床参考点是机床位置测量系统的点是机床位置测量系统的基准点基准点,一般位于机床各坐一般位于机床各坐标轴正向极限位置的附近标轴正向极限位置的附近,与机床原点的距离是固定与机床原点的距离是固定的的.通常机床原点与参考点通常机床原点与参考点重合重合.每次机床开机后要进每次机床开机后要进行行回参考点回参考点回参考点回参考点的操作的操作,目的就目的就是为了确定机床原点的位是为了确定机床原点的位置置,同时建立机床坐标系同时建立机床坐标系.26262.工件坐标系与工件原点A.A.工件坐标系工件坐标系:
工件坐标系是由编程者制定的工件坐标系是由编程者制定的,以工件上某一个以工件上某一个固定点为原点的右手直角坐标系固定点为原点的右手直角坐标系,又称为编程坐标又称为编程坐标系系.工件坐标系与机床坐标系之间的差别在于原工件坐标系与机床坐标系之间的差别在于原点的位置不同点的位置不同.由于机床坐标系的原点不在工件上由于机床坐标系的原点不在工件上,利用机床坐标系去编程是非常困难的利用机床坐标系去编程是非常困难的.为了有利于为了有利于编程编程,我们需要建立工件坐标系我们需要建立工件坐标系,编程时所有的坐编程时所有的坐标值都是假设刀具的运动轨迹点在工件坐标系中标值都是假设刀具的运动轨迹点在工件坐标系中的位置的位置,而不必考虑工件毛坯在机床上的实际装夹而不必考虑工件毛坯在机床上的实际装夹位置位置.2727工件坐标系原点的设置原则
(1)
(1)
(1)
(1)设置在工件的工艺基准或设置在工件的工艺基准或设置在工件的工艺基准或设置在工件的工艺基准或设计基准上。
设计基准上。
设计基准上。
设计基准上。
(2)
(2)
(2)
(2)设置在尺寸精度高和表面设置在尺寸精度高和表面设置在尺寸精度高和表面设置在尺寸精度高和表面粗糙度低的位置。
粗糙度低的位置。
粗糙度低的位置。
粗糙度低的位置。
(3)(3)(3)(3)便于测量和编程。
便于测量和编程。
便于测量和编程。
便于测量和编程。
我们利用工件坐标我们利用工件坐标我们利用工件坐标我们利用工件坐标系编程时系编程时系编程时系编程时,不必考虑工件不必考虑工件不必考虑工件不必考虑工件在机床内的安装位置在机床内的安装位置在机床内的安装位置在机床内的安装位置,但但但但在自动加工时则需要确在自动